Many property owners turn to mulch delivery services to address common landscaping challenges. Mulch helps suppress weeds, retain soil moisture, and regulate soil temperature, which can improve plant health and reduce maintenance. It also provides a finished look to gardens and landscape beds, increasing curb appeal. The overview below groups typical Mulch Delivery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Landscaping Projects - For routine mulch delivery jobs such as flower beds or small garden areas, costs typically range from $250 to $600.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on the volume of mulch needed. Fewer jobs reach the higher end of the spectrum for larger or more complex deliveries.
Medium-sized Garden Beds - Larger landscaping projects, including multiple beds or a sizable yard, generally cost between $600 and $1,200. These are common for homeowners looking to refresh or expand their mulch coverage, with costs varying based on area size and mulch type.
Large-scale Installations - For extensive landscaping or commercial properties requiring significant mulch amounts, costs often range from $1,200 to $3,000. Such projects are less frequent but are typical for larger properties or multiple areas needing mulch delivery.
Full Property Mulch Replacement - Complete overhaul or large-scale mulch replacement for entire properties can reach $3,000 or more. These projects are less common and involve substantial volume, often requiring specialized equipment and labor from local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of mulch do local contractors deliver? Local mulch delivery services typically offer a variety of mulch types, including bark, cedar, pine, and rubber mulch, to suit different landscaping needs.
How is mulch delivered to my property? Local service providers usually deliver mulch directly to your driveway or designated area, using trucks equipped to handle bulk materials safely and efficiently.
